Stimulants

Stimulants are drugs that "stimulate" brain activities and processes. They can help improve focus, increase energy and alertness, and increase attention. They also increase blood pressure and heart rate.

They can trigger negative side effects, such as decreased appetite or trouble sleeping but are generally safe to use long-term. They're usually taken once or twice daily according to the medication. They are available in chewable, liquid or pill form. Some are short-acting, lasting only a few hours. Some are long-acting, and stay in the body up to 16 hours.

The most popular medications used to treat ADHD are methylphenidate (Ritalin) dextroamphetamine, dextroamphetamine salts (Adderall), and atomoxetine (Strattera). These drugs affect brain chemicals called norepinephrine and dopamine. They're known to boost attention and reduce the impulsivity, hyperactivity, and restlessness.

Some people with ADHD may be tempted to abuse stimulants that are frequently prescribed to others or even sold illegally. Misusing stimulants may lead to addiction and other health issues. It can also increase the likelihood of suffering from anxiety, depression and other mental health issues.

Other medications for treating ADHD do not act on the same chemical as stimulants. These include clonidine, guanfacine and atomoxetine. These are helpful for people who cannot tolerate stimulant medication or have a medical issue that makes them too much. These medications take longer to begin working however they can enhance the ability of a person to pay attention and control their emotions.

People who suffer from ADHD who take stimulant ADHD medications should avoid alcohol and other drugs that speed up the nervous system. This includes some over-the-counter cough and cold medicines and some diet supplements, and some prescription medications that can cause jitteriness. Stimulant ADHD medications can intensify the effects of alcohol, and even a small amount of alcohol could lead to feelings of drunkenness faster than in those who don't use the medication. Before taking stimulants suffering from depression or other mood disorders should to speak with their doctor. They may have to alter the dosage or stop taking the medication.
